The County refers us to Central Ga. Power Co. v. Cornwell, 143 Ga. 9, 10 ( 84 SE 67 ) (1915), in which our Supreme Court ruled that the trial court did not err in rejecting the testimony of a witness as to consequential damages which was a statement “in general terms that he thinks a named amount would probably be a fair estimate of the consequential damages to the land not taken.” Here, however, Blount’s testimony was not excluded, and the question is not, as in Cornwell, w…
